- 4-H Gateway Academy sites expand to reach 500 middle school students with science, technology, engineering and math learning opportunities this summer
- RACINE—University of Wisconsin Colleges and University of Wisconsin-Extension Chancellor David Wilson and Kern Family Foundation President James Rahn on Thursday announced the expansion of the 4-H Gateway Academy to 20 sites, with the potential to reach 500 middle-schoolers around the state this summer.

- Statewide Challenge Encourages Schools to Boost Breakfast Participation
- MADISON, WIS.--The University of Wisconsin-Extension and the state Department of Public Instruction are challenging Wisconsin schools to increase their student participation in school breakfast programs by 50 percent during the 2008-09 school year.
